#aa6304 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aa6304 is composed of 66.7% red, 38.8%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.8% magenta, 97.6%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 34.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.4% and a lightness of 34.1%. #aa6304 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c608 with #550000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#aa6304

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110a00 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#aa6304

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5754 is the less saturated color, while #aa6304 is the most saturated one.
